Wood Window Service in Greensboro, NC
Wood window services encompass a range of projects focused on the repair, restoration, and maintenance of wooden window frames, sashes, and casings. Homeowners often seek these services for issues such as rotting wood, drafts, broken or cracked glass, or to improve energy efficiency and curb appeal. Projects may include replacing damaged wood components, restoring old or historic windows to preserve their character, or upgrading existing windows for better insulation and functionality.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of work involved, the materials used, and the expected outcomes to ensure their windows meet both aesthetic and performance goals.
Before requesting wood window services, property owners should consider the age and condition of their windows, as well as any specific needs related to energy efficiency or historical preservation. It’s helpful to know whether the project involves simple repairs or requires full replacement, and to inquire about the types of wood or finishes available. Clarifying these details can assist in selecting the most suitable approach for maintaining the integrity and appearance of the windows while ensuring long-term durability.

Common Wood Window Service Jobs
Wood window restoration - restoring aged or damaged wood frames to improve appearance and functionality.
Wood window repair - fixing cracks, rot, or broken components to extend the lifespan of existing windows.
Wood window replacement - installing new wood windows to enhance energy efficiency and curb appeal.
Wood window hardware upgrade - updating latches, locks, and hinges for better security and operation.
Custom wood window fabrication - creating tailored wood windows to match unique architectural styles.
Wood window maintenance - performing cleaning, sealing, and protective treatments to preserve wood surfaces.
Wood Window Service Questions
What types of wood windows are serviced? Services include repairs, restoration, and replacement of various wood window styles such as double-hung, casement, and picture windows.
Can damaged wood windows be restored? Yes, many wood windows can be repaired through wood filling, sanding, and sealing to extend their lifespan.
What signs indicate that a wood window needs service? Common signs include rotting wood, difficulty opening or closing, drafts, or visible warping and cracking.
Are custom wood window sizes available? Custom sizing options are often available to match existing window openings or specific design preferences.
